Objective: To investigate the causes and outcome of fever of unknown origin(FUO) and to summarize its clinical features, occurrence regularity so as to provide useful reference for its clinical diagnosis. Methods: A retrospective study of 80 patients’ pathogenic diagnosis of the FUO from pneumology department was made to analyze the relationship between the cause and sex, age, course of fever, diagnosis time. Results: 1.There were 70 definitely diagnosed patients among 80 FUO ones, accounting for 87.5% and 10 undiagnosed patients, accounting for 12.5%. 5 patients(6.3%) died from infectious diseases. The causes of the 70 definitely diagnosed patients were listed as follows:(1) infectious diseases led to 49 patients(61.3%). Tuberculosis ranked top for among the 49 patients 17(21.3%) suffered from tuberculosis, 15(18.8%) had TB and 2(2.5%) had extrapulmonary tuberculosis; Stroke-associated pneumonia came next, 11(13.8%) were with it; 5 cases(6.3%) suffered from brucellosis;(2) 14 patients(17.5%) had rheumatological disease among whom 5(6.3%) were with adult Still’s disease(3) neoplastic disease in 3 patients(3.8%) who had lymphoma, colon cancer, lung cancer respectively;(4) other causes of four cases(5.0%). 2. Has obvious between different disease types and gender difference was statistically significant(2? =8.316,P<0.05). 3. Different kinds of disease in different age the distribution of no statistical significance(2? =3.389,P>0.05).4. Different disease types on the heating time has significant difference was statistically significant(2? =30.898,P<0.05).5. Different kinds of disease diagnosis time differences statistically(2? =24.662,P<0.05). 6. In patients with FUO, Yin deficiency type(22/80, 27.5%), table hot type(14/80, 17.5%) and autumn dry type accounted for 12.5%(10/80) is higher than other type of syndrome.Conclusion: Infection and connective tissue disease is a major disease of FUO, and TB is still the first reason of infectious diseases causing FUO. And it can not be ignored in clinical. At the same time we must pay attention to some special infectious endemic disease, for animal husbandry in Xinjiang province, the economic, environmental, health, medical level is poorer, associated with brucellosis and AIDS cannot be ignored. The tend in clinical diagnosis such as tumor, little delay to FUO. In view of the clinical diagnosis of FUO, we should consider the difference of the different disease types and gender, age, heat process and the diagnosis time. It has the certain guide significance to the clinical diagnosis. Thus we consider that the FUO is due to the atypical manifestation of common disease, we should follow the "individualized therapeutic principles", carry on the detailed and comprehensive medical history data collection and analysis. And most FUO cases could be diagnosised..
